Transaction f66a46b91ca718228128a4fbf827fff9c1e360efd8e499f14be51ae805881782
2 Input
2 Outputs
- f66a46b91ca718228128a4fbf827fff9c1e360efd8e499f14be51ae805881782:0
- f66a46b91ca718228128a4fbf827fff9c1e360efd8e499f14be51ae805881782:1
value 1000767
address 1KXGKxn3PmE3LjBbg9TQhhMv8ewt1wwQi6
value 22678480
address 1CiMVTLAxBsJBLtrVTR5CjyhrzdhprvTu2